Safety centre
Consent, privacy, transparent AI, community controls, and realistic expectations are built into the Fashy product—not left to fine print.
Source photos and generated concepts are owner-authenticated and private until you explicitly publish a concept.
Generated looks carry an AI Concept label and are framed as creative visualization—not proof, exact fit, or a production guarantee.
Prompts and imagery pass automated safety checks. Higher-risk content can be blocked or escalated for review.
Report public content from its options menu. We review context and provide an appeal path through support.
Blocking hides an account’s content and restricts future interaction. Immediate threats should also go to local authorities.
Designer verification checks current curation criteria, while customers still review portfolios, quotes, and order terms.
